Insulation Materials for Thermal Gloves

Thermal work gloves are designed to trap body heat and block cold air. But not all insulation materials5 work the same way.

Insulation Material Pros Cons Best For
Thinsulate Lightweight, excellent warmth, breathable May not perform well in extremely wet conditions Construction, logistics, outdoor work
Fleece Soft, breathable, comfortable Less effective in extreme cold Moderate cold environments, indoor work
Wool Retains heat even when wet, natural insulator May be bulky and heavy Agriculture, cold storage, outdoor work

While insulation matters, the outer material is just as important. In wet conditions, gloves with waterproof membranes6 like Gore-Tex prevent moisture from reducing insulation effectiveness.

🔹 Key Consideration: Fit is crucial. If gloves are too loose, they allow cold air in. If they are too tight, circulation is restricted, reducing warmth.

How to Choose Thermal Work Gloves?

Whenever I help customers choose thermal work gloves, I ask them about their specific work conditions10. Some need gloves for sub-zero temperatures11, while others need waterproof protection or extra grip for tool handling.

You need to consider insulation type (Thinsulate, fleece, or wool), outer protection (waterproof coatings like nitrile or latex), and fit for dexterity. Industry-specific needs, such as cut resistance or reinforced grip, should also be evaluated.

Bullsafety Thermal Gloves

Key Factors to Consider

1️⃣ Insulation Type – Thinsulate provides warmth without bulk, wool retains heat when wet, and fleece is breathable for moderate conditions.
2️⃣ Outer Layer Material – Durable materials like nylon, polyester, or leather protect against wind and abrasion.
3️⃣ Water Resistance & Waterproofing – Look for Gore-Tex membranes or latex/nitrile coatings in wet environments.
4️⃣ Grip & Dexterity – Reinforced palms or rubberized coatings help when handling tools or machinery.
5️⃣ Fit & Comfort – A snug but flexible fit prevents cold air from entering while maintaining hand mobility.

FAQs

1. Are Thermal Work Gloves Waterproof?

Not all thermal gloves are waterproof. If you work in wet or snowy conditions, choose gloves with a waterproof membrane like Gore-Tex or latex/nitrile coatings.

2. Do Thermal Gloves Reduce Dexterity?

It depends on the insulation type. Thinsulate gloves provide warmth without bulk, while wool gloves can be thicker and less flexible.

3. How Do I Know If My Gloves Are Certified for Cold Protection?

Look for gloves tested under EN511 (cold protection) or ANSI standards for cut and abrasion resistance.
